A senior planner at Fenwick Grid has missed the last three Friday schedule updates for a predictive substation overhaul. The project manager sees the planner is consistently at their desk until 19:00 hours.

What should the project manager do first?

  1. Escalate the missed updates to the project sponsor as a risk to the project's critical path.
  2. Schedule a private meeting with the planner to understand the challenges they are facing with the updates.
  3. Issue a formal written warning regarding the missed commitments in the project's next status report, after reviewing the current risk register entries.
  4. Contact the planner's functional manager to request a replacement who can meet the deadlines.
